Job summary

Amcor is seeking a dedicated manufacturing associate at our Bowling Green, KY facility to support safe production and efficient operations. You will follow safety and food safety requirements, wear PPE, manage materials, and operate equipment including shrink wrap and resin handling systems.

Qualifications include a high school diploma or GED, reliable attendance, and the ability to pass tests and a PIT license.

Qualifications

  • Capable of physical mobility including sitting, bending, twisting, standing, and lifting up to 50 lbs.
  • Maintain an attendance record within company guidelines and working required overtime.
  • High school diploma or GED equivalency preferred.
  • Read, write and speak English.
  • Past experience / proven ability within the specified disciplines.
  • Negative drug screen test results.
  • Capable of operating a Powered Industrial Truck (PIT) in a safe and cautious manner. Must pass the PIT operator test and obtain a valid Berry PIT license.
  • Capable of passing a written basic skills test with a score of 75% or better.

Responsibilities

  • Observe all Safety precautions, Food Safety requirements and plant rules to prevent injury to self or others and to prevent loss of material or damage to equipment.
  • Follow and wear all required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).
  • Maintain good housekeeping and 5S.
  • Supply machines with required and correct materials.
  • Transport finished goods pallets to staging area as directed.
  • Safely operate shrink wrap machines and document alarms or nonconformities as directed.
  • Operate resin handling system including bulk rail car unloading system, silo, bin, storage, and conveying system from bins to machines.
  • Transport nonconforming / rejected product to/from hold areas as required.
  • Collect and move scrap items to the appropriate scrap area.
  • Operate grinder, clear jams, clean grinding area, if applicable.
